Insulin:
During aerobic exercise, insulin levels drop quickly due to an inhibitory effect on it's release from the pancreas by adrenaline (20, 21). The drop in insulin allows free fatty acid release to occur from the fat cells during exercise.

INSULIN-LIKE GROWTH FACTORS, IGFs (Anabolic)
Many of the GH effects are transported through IGFs. IGF-1 is the primary IGF involved with respect to exercise. IGF has a major role in protein synthesis.

Aerobic exercise is proving to have significant and particular benefits for people with both type 1 and type 2 diabetes; it increases sensitivity to insulin, lowers blood pressure, improves cholesterol levels, and decreases body fat.

The endocrine part of the pancreas consists of clumps of cells called islets of Langerhans that secrete insulin. Insulin regulates the sugar level in the blood and the conversion of sugar into heat and energy.

In diabetes, the immune system attacks the insulin-producing beta cells in the pancreas and destroys them. The pancreas then produces little or no insulin. A person who has type 1 diabetes must take insulin daily to live.

Exercising regularly improves the ability of insulin to enter cells, so it lowers the risk of diabetes. It also lowers the risk of heart disease by improving blood clotting mechanisms, lowering triglycerides, and raising HDL (good) cholesterol.
